About This Item

Henry Regnery Company, Chicago, ILL, 1963. Hardcover. Condition: Very Good. Dust jacket condition: Good+. Signed first edition. 334 pp. Text clean and unmarked on ivory colored paper. Author signed dedication on front free endpaper. Dust jacket has chips, shelf wear and is separated into two pieces. Mrs. Walgreen, the widow of the drugstore chain founder, "recalls her childhood in Southern Illinois and the city, Chicago, which became 'an inseparable part of us'"
